DRF’s Illman to Receive Old Hilltop Award at Pimlico

To Be Recognized at Alibi Breakfast Thursday, May 16

LAUREL, MD – Dan Illman, longtime handicapper and writer for the Daily Racing Form (DRF) and executive producer for DRF’s video productions, has been named recipient of the 2024 Old Hilltop Award for covering Thoroughbred racing with excellence and distinction.

Illman will be presented with the Old Hilltop Award May 16 at the Alibi Breakfast at Pimlico Race Course during Preakness Week. The Alibi Breakfast began in the 1930s on the porch of the old Pimlico Clubhouse and features a gathering of media, owners, trainers, jockeys, horsemen, and fans to celebrate the Preakness and gain interesting and humorous race predictions.

A racing fan since childhood, Illman, lead anchor for DRF’s handicapping videos since 2003, grew up on Long Island halfway between Belmont Park and Aqueduct. A graduate of Nova Southeastern University, Illman began his career at Sports Eye. Illman has authored “Betting Maidens & Two-Year-Olds,” has appeared on ESPN, MSG and TVG, and compiles DRF’s Weekly Divisional Ratings. He has been DRF’s Mid-Atlantic correspondent since 2020.

“I am very honored to receive the Old Hilltop Award from the Maryland Jockey Club,” Illman said. “I fell in love with racing the first time I went to Belmont Park as a child, snuck the Daily Racing Form into my high school classes, and am very grateful to live my dream by covering the sport each day. The last few years of reporting on the Mid-Atlantic region, especially Maryland racing, have been the most rewarding of my career.”
